The role

The objective of this possition is to engineer novel nanoparticle designs that optimize plasmonic photo-thermal effects and are custom-made for neuronal stimulation. Previous works used commercially available spherical gold nanoparticles that were not ideal, as they were not designed for neuroscience applications. We propose a systematic strategy based on artificial intelligence to design nanoparticles for neuronal photoactivation.

The hired person will be in charge of the creation of a library of nanostructures and their optical response and Training of neural networks. He/she will explore machine learning algorithms to optimize nanoparticle designs for optimal heat generation. Moreover, this person should also use the approximate results coming out of neural networks as feeds for iterative exact solvers of Maxwell equations.

About the team

The project will be mostly developed in the research groups of Aitzol Garcia-Etxarri and Ignacio Arganda. Nevertheless the project will be carried out in the scope of the Basque NanoNeuro Network (B3N), a consortium of laboratories working at the interface of nanoscience and neuroscience. B3N is a multidisciplinary consortium, which combines synergetically research groups from different research fields. Specifically, the DIPC specializes on the study of the electromagnetic response of matter at the nanoscale, MPC is on charge of wet-chemistry synthesis of new biocompatible nanomaterials, FBB will carry out the functionalization of NPs, Achucarro studies the neuropathological mechanisms at the cellular and animal level, BioDonostia on in-vitro models and ex-vivo and in-vivo clinical research, CIC biomaGUNE will focus on the interaction between carbon nanomaterials and neurons and bio-imaging and Tecnalia will take care of the technological supervision, neuromodulation technology, bioelectromagnetism and technological transfer management.
